Titanium dioxide nanofiber-cotton targets for efficient multi-keV x-ray generation

Description
Multi-keV x-ray generation from low-density (27±7 mg/cm3) nanofiber-cotton targets composed of titanium dioxide has been investigated. The cotton targets were heated volumetrically and supersonically to a peak electron temperature of 2.3 keV, which is optimal to yield Ti K-shell x rays. Considerable enhancement of conversion efficiency [(3.7±0.5)%] from incident laser energy into Ti K-shell x rays (4-6 keV band) was attained in comparison with that [(1.4±0.9)%] for a planar Ti-foil target
